Nagyagite, or lead antimony sulphide gold telluride, is one of those rare mineral species reported from many localities around the world, but only one area has produced significant noteworthy crystals - that of the Type Locality, after which it is named. This wonderful miniature specimen from Săcărâmb (formerly Nagyág) has remarkably fine aesthetics for a rare species. Its display surface (5 x 4 cm), features attractive dendritic, or fan-like, growths of black bladed crystals of Nagyagite embedded in pale pink Rhodochrosite.
